2.0.0 - 2025-07-08 #
💥 Breaking Changes #
- Synchronous API: The plugin's core methods are now synchronous to improve performance. This affects how you create, use, and dispose of the plugin.
HandLandmarkerPlugin.create()no longer returns a Future.HandLandmarkerPlugin.dispose()is now synchronous.- The
detect()method is now a synchronous, blocking call. You must manage how frequently you call it to avoid blocking the UI thread.
✨ Features & Performance #
- Native Image Processing (BREAKING): Rearchitected the plugin to perform all YUV image conversion natively in Kotlin. This eliminates the Dart background isolate and significantly reduces data transfer overhead for much lower latency. (347f5f1)
- GPU Acceleration: Enabled the MediaPipe GPU delegate by default to accelerate model inference, resulting in smoother real-time performance. (4749d8c)
